README ¶ Advent of Code solutions in Go How to run You need go version go1.21.x to run the solutions. Uncomment your wanted solution in main.go and run it with go run main.go in the root dir of this repository. The input has to be put in a input.txt file in for example: ./2023/day01/input.txt.
